Meyer Shank Racing driver Marcus Armstrong is gearing up for an exciting 2026 IndyCar season, showcasing remarkable growth and determination.

Armstrong’s Journey in IndyCar

The 2026 season will mark Armstrong’s fourth year in IndyCar racing and his second with Meyer Shank Racing (MSR). He made his debut in 2023, participating in a road course and street circuit program in the #11 car with Chip Ganassi Racing, where he earned Rookie of the Year honors. Armstrong transitioned to a full-time role in 2024, achieving his first podium finish on the streets of Detroit.

In 2025, Chip Ganassi Racing scaled down to three cars, leading to Armstrong being loaned to Meyer Shank Racing. With MSR, he has experienced his most successful season to date, currently sitting ninth in the drivers’ championship with two races remaining. So far, Armstrong has secured one podium finish and ten top-10 finishes out of 15 races.

Looking Ahead

“I’m very pleased and grateful to be back with Meyer Shank Racing and my crew for 2026,” said Armstrong. “The professionalism and attention to detail is a benchmark throughout the field, and we have certainly improved with time together, which has been great. We’ll look to build on our momentum and work hard to climb the points standings.”

With Meyer Shank Racing, Armstrong also achieved his best qualifying performance, finishing third in Toronto.

Team’s Excitement

“We’re thrilled to have Marcus back for 2026,” said Mike Shank, co-owner of Meyer Shank Racing. “He’s really grown a lot this season, and we’re seeing that in his results as the season has progressed. His performance this year has demonstrated that he has all the tools to compete at the front. We’re excited to continue building on this progress together.”

The IndyCar Series will continue at the Milwaukee Mile on Monday, August 25 (AEST).
